For Ability, I would have to suggest Synchronize. It's an excellent Ability for Mew since it lets Mew afflict its opponent with Burn, Poison, or Paralysis when Mew itself is afflicted with one of those status conditions. Switch Mew in on those nasty Clef TWaves or Rotom Wisps and you can end up crippling your opponents. Synchronize is definitely the best Ability for Mew hands down.
 
Mew @Leftovers
Ability: Synchronise
EVs: 248 HP / 146 Def / 112 Spe
- Ice Beam
- Soft Boiled
- Will-o-Wisp
- Stealth Rock


A pretty standard mew set. Ice beam stops things like Zygarde setting up on it. Wisp cripples physical threats switching in like Bisharp. Stealth Rock and Soft Boiled are self explanatory.
